Definition & Meaning
The "FINAL DWC Form IMR docx - dir ca" is an essential document utilized within California’s workers' compensation system. It stands for the Division of Workers' Compensation's Independent Medical Review (IMR) form, which allows employees to formally challenge denials or modifications of their medical treatment requests. This form provides a systematic approach for workers seeking a review of medical decisions related to their compensation claims. The form is pivotal in ensuring fair treatment of employees by offering a legal pathway to contest medical treatment decisions.
Steps to Complete the FINAL DWC Form IMR docx - dir ca
Completing the form entails several key steps to ensure accuracy and compliance:
- Gather Necessary Information: Collect details about the employee, including their personal data and specifics about the medical treatment dispute.
- Fill Out Employee Section: Provide accurate personal and employment information, including employee identification numbers and contact information.
- Describe the Medical Treatment Dispute: Clearly outline the medical treatment that has been denied or altered, detailing what was originally requested and the decision made by the insurance company or employer.
- Consent for Medical Records: Complete the section granting consent for the review panel to access relevant medical records. This ensures the IMR process is comprehensive and informed.
- Designation of an Authorized Representative (if applicable): If the employee wishes to designate someone to act on their behalf during the review, this section must be completed.
- Review and Sign: Carefully review all entered information for accuracy before signing the form to certify its correctness.

Who Typically Uses the FINAL DWC Form IMR docx - dir ca
The primary users of this form are employees within the California workers' compensation system who have experienced a denial or alteration of a medical treatment request. Additionally, authorized representatives, including attorneys or advocates, may assist these employees in completing and submitting the form. Employers and insurance companies might reference or utilize information from the IMR form during disputes or in preparing their responses.
